Instagram Reels and TikTok share the same winning formula: vertical video, strong first frame, clear stakes, and a payoff before thirty seconds. Challenge videos fit that mold naturally.
Step one: pick a recognizable format — emoji order, memory flash, reaction tap, or eyesight test. Step two: record with your face visible. Authentic reaction beats polished silence. Step three: show the score on screen so viewers know if you won or lost.

Hooks for Reels: text overlay “Bet you can’t beat 8,” audio trend under gameplay, or jump-cut from confident intro to fail moment. Export from ChallengeCam at full vertical resolution and upload natively — avoid cross-platform watermarks when possible.
Post timing and series matter as much as single clips. “Day 12 of reaction challenges” trains your audience to return. ChallengeCam’s template catalog makes daily recording sustainable.
